Risk Management
Plan exits with R-multiples. Given entry, stop, and reward multiple, get take-profit price and expected reward:risk.
R-multiples keep targets proportional to risk. A 2R target aims for twice the dollars you would lose if stopped out — useful for journaling expectancy.
Risk per unit = |Entry − Stop|. Long TP = Entry + (R × risk). Short TP = Entry − (R × risk). Reward = R × (risk × units).
Entry $65,000, stop $63,000 → risk $2,000/unit. 2R TP = $69,000. On 0.1 BTC, risk $200 and reward $400.
Entry $65,000, stop $66,000 → risk $1,000/unit. 1.5R TP = $63,500.
Many systematic plans look for at least 1.5R–3R when win rate is moderate. Match targets to market structure, not vanity numbers.
